Flamouriá is a small town in Central Macedonia, Greece with a population of 661. Elevation: 1,037 ft (316 m). Average temperature: 57°F (14°C).

Climate & Weather

Flamouriá enjoys a moderate climate with an average annual temperature of 57°F. Winters average 38°F in January while summers reach 76°F in July. With 303 sunny days per year, residents enjoy well above the national average of sunshine. Annual precipitation totals 18.2 inches. Air quality is rated Moderate with a median AQI of 57.

Flamouriá has a seasonal temperature swing of 39°F — from 38°F in January to 76°F in July. Total annual precipitation is 18.2 inches, with November being the wettest month (2.2") and August the driest (1.1").
